Problem
Generating CRISPR-edited cell lines with high efficiency and reliability is time-consuming and requires specialized expertise, often delaying research and increasing costs. Traditional methods involve extensive optimization and can yield inconsistent results, hindering scientific progress.
Solution
EditCo Bio provides optimized CRISPR reagents and engineered cell lines, streamlining genome editing for cell biology and gene therapy research. The company leverages a high-throughput cell editing platform and multi-guide RNA designs to deliver efficient and consistent gene knockouts and knock-ins. EditCo offers a range of products, including gene knockout kits, arrayed gRNA libraries, immortalized cells, iPS cells, and primary cells, enabling researchers to accelerate their discoveries. Their XDel CRISPR technology improves editing accuracy and minimizes off-target effects, ensuring reliable results for various applications, including disease modeling, drug target identification, and cell and gene therapy development.

Features
- XDel CRISPR technology utilizing multi-guide RNA for high on-target editing efficiency and minimal off-target effects
- Gene knockout kits with a unique multi-guide RNA strategy for efficient and consistent knockouts in human and mouse cell lines
- Arrayed CRISPR sgRNA libraries for high-throughput screening with guaranteed editing efficiency
- Custom-engineered immortalized, iPS, and primary cells with knockout and knock-in capabilities
- Automated cell line editing process for consistent performance and scalability
- Comprehensive QC reports including mycoplasma testing, passage number, and sequencing analysis
- Option for EditCo-supplied or customer-supplied cell lines
- ICE CRISPR analysis tool for evaluating editing efficiency
